Transaction 54d1846e23993cef90bf56214a5f0f4128e9c78d3be5ccfd48cae995012113d5

3 Input
2 Outputs
  • 54d1846e23993cef90bf56214a5f0f4128e9c78d3be5ccfd48cae995012113d5:0
  • value  2081039114
    address  32FZAntXeax8PGYM3ur2BQpcS7pNRZ1Rp5
  • 54d1846e23993cef90bf56214a5f0f4128e9c78d3be5ccfd48cae995012113d5:1
  • value  47393365
    address  1NjsH2e7i5ZKoasCCSUDS2LRaLJk4XnrNB